David Furnish on Facebook
Monday, November 10 2014

Following Elton's performance in St. Peterburg on November 9, 2014, David Furnish posted the following on Facebook.

Elton performed in St. Petersburg Russia tonight. When he last performed in Moscow, he bravely spoke out about the horrific anti-propaganda laws that discriminate against LGBT people in Russia.

He met with LGBT groups on the ground there and they supported his visit and praised his speech. Some artists have chosen to boycott Russia altogether, but the LGBT groups we spoke to were against that. They said a boycott would further isolate them and push them deeper into the cracks of society.

They asked Elton to return and to continue to speak out in their support.

Here is a transcript of what he said on stage in St. Petersburg tonight:

"I'm not big on technology, but I love my i-Pad. They’re amazing…aren’t they? They way they can connect us to the things and people we love….

How dignified that St Petersburg should erect a memorial to Steve Jobs, the remarkable founder of Apple.
But last week it was labeled ‘homosexual propaganda’ and taken down!

Can this be true? Steve’s memory is re-written because his successor at Apple, Tim Cook, is gay? Does that also make i-pads gay propaganda? Is Tchaikovsky’s beautiful music ‘sexually perverting’?

As a gay man, I’ve always felt so welcome here in Russia. Stories of Russian fans - men and women who fell in love dancing to’Nikita’ or their kids who sing along to ‘Circle of Life’ -- mean the world to me.

If I’m not honest about who I am, I couldn’t write this music. It’s not gay propaganda. It’s how I express life. If we start punishing people for that, the world will lose it’s humanity.

Hate is ugly. Love is beautiful."

Elton's speech was met was thunderous applause and at the end of the night he received a standing ovation.
Love is beautiful indeed!
